.
QQ扫一扫联系
如何使用 CSS3 过渡和动画制作页面导航效果
CSS3提供了丰富的过渡和动画效果,可以为网页添加各种交互和视觉效果。其中,制作页面导航效果是一项常见而有趣的任务。本文将介绍如何使用CSS3过渡和动画来制作页面导航效果,让您的网页更加生动和吸引人。
创建导航基础结构:
首先,我们需要创建一个基本的导航结构,通常使用HTML的无序列表(<ul>
)和列表项(<li>
)来表示导航菜单。
定义导航样式: 使用CSS来定义导航菜单的样式,包括背景色、文字颜色、边框等。可以根据需求进行自定义,使导航菜单与网页整体风格相匹配。
添加过渡效果:
过渡效果可以实现平滑的状态变化,使导航菜单在鼠标悬停或点击时产生过渡效果。通过为导航菜单的状态(:hover
、:active
等)设置过渡属性,如颜色、背景色、边框等,可以创建出炫酷的过渡效果。
应用动画效果:
除了过渡效果,我们还可以为导航菜单添加动画效果,使其在特定的事件或条件下产生动态效果。例如,使用关键帧动画(@keyframes
)来定义导航菜单的动画序列,然后将其应用到适当的状态(:hover
、:active
等)下。
响应式设计: 考虑到不同设备和屏幕尺寸的适配,我们还可以使用媒体查询来调整导航菜单的样式和布局。通过设置不同的样式规则和布局属性,使导航菜单在不同设备上呈现出最佳的用户体验。
浏览器兼容性:
在使用CSS3过渡和动画效果时,需要注意不同浏览器对这些特性的支持程度。可以使用浏览器前缀(-webkit-
、-moz-
等)来提供跨浏览器的兼容性。
总结: 通过使用CSS3过渡和动画,我们可以为页面导航菜单添加交互和视觉效果,使其更加生动和吸引人。通过定义过渡效果和动画序列,我们可以实现平滑的状态变化和动态效果。同时,结合响应式设计和浏览器兼容性处理,可以确保导航效果在不同设备和浏览器中的良好表现。使用CSS3过渡和动画制作页面导航效果,将为您的网页增添活力和创意。
.